Найти в Дзене
Мастер на все руки

Знакомство с одноплатным микрокомпьютером Raspberry Pi 3 model B

Оглавление

В этой статье я предлагаю Вам познакомиться с одноплатным микрокомпьютером Raspberry Pi. Все "малины" +- походи между собой, отличия только в процессоре и оперативной памяти. Правда в моделях RPi 1 и 2 еще и отсутствует wi-fi модуль, хотя их в продаже уже тяжело найти, поэтому знакомится с этими моделями нет никакого смысла :)

Мы же начнем знакомство с RPi 3 model B

Raspberry Pi 3 model B
Raspberry Pi 3 model B

На самом деле эта, на вид, маленькая игрушка является полноценным бесшумным компьютером размером с банковскую карту, при этом с 64-х битным четырёхядерным процессором ARM Cortex-A53 на однокристальном чипе Broadcom BCM2837.

Характеристики RPi 3B

  • Процессор: 64-битный 4-ядерный ARM Cortex-A53 на однокристальном чипе Broadcom BCM2837;
  • Тактовая частота: 1,2 ГГц
  • Оперативная память: 1ГБ LPDDR2 SDRAM;
  • Цифровой аудио/видео выход: HDMI;
  • Композитный аудио/видео выход: 3,5 мм (4 pin);
  • USB порты: USB 2.0×4;
  • Сеть:
    WiFi: 802.11n;
    Ethernet: 10/100 Мб RJ45;
  • Bluetooth: Bluetooth 4.1, Bluetooth Low Energy;
  • Разъем дисплея: Display Serial Interface (DSI);
  • Разъем видеокамеры: MIPI Camera Serial Interface (CSI-2);
  • Карта памяти: MicroSD;
  • Порты ввода-вывода: 40;
  • Габариты: 85×56×17 мм.

У этой малышки большой потенциал как для использования в серьезных проектах, так и в обучении детей, ведь на этом компьютере можно собирать различные умные игрушки(роботы, машинки, вычислительные станции), а так же использовать в серьезных проектах, например управление умными устройствами(об этом будет описано в следующих статьях с подробным описанием :) )

Сегодня рассмотрим первоначальный запуск и настройку этого чудо компьютера. RPi работает на линукс системе.

Установка и настройка Linux Debian на RPi 3B

Для начала нам необходимо где-нибудь раздобыть сам микрокомпьютер Raspberry Pi 3 , затем с официального сайта raspberrypi нужно скачать операционную систему Raspbian (для большей производительности, необходимо установить Lite версию Rasbian без графического интерфейса, но если охота видеть рабочий стол при загрузке операционной системы, а не командную строку, то рекомендую устанавливать Rasbian с графическим интерфейсом)

Далее нам приготовить следующее оборудование:

  • Устройство Raspberry Pi 3
  • Карта памяти MicroSD 10 класс, 8 Гб
  • Блок питания с выходом 5 В/2 А MicroUSB
  • Компьютер с ОС Windows, кард-ридером и Ethernet-портом
  • Ethernet-маршрутизатор со включенным DHCP-сервером
  • Доступ в интернет (опционально)

Еще нам необходимо скачать несколько дополнительных программ:

  • Win32 Disk Imager (или аналогичные программы, например, WinToFlash или Rufus), для записи образа операционной системы на нашу MicroSD карту.
  • Advanced Port Scanner (или другой сканер LAN-сети) чтобы в дальнейшем обнаружить нашу малинку в нашей локальной сети.
  • Putty - для подключения к RPI по SSH порту.

Следующим этапом нам потребуется разархивировать архив образа ОС Raspbian. Будет получен файл образа *.img.

Записываем образ Raspbian Jessie на карту памяти, используя кард-ридер и Win32 Disk Imager. Для этого картридер с microSD картой вставляем в компьютер и запускаем программу Win32 Disk Imager. В поле Image File выбираем путь к разархивированному образу rasbian, в поле Device выбираем нашу SD карту. После этих действий необходимо нажать на кнопку "Write", соглашаемся с пунктом, что все данные с нашей sd карту будут удалены, а на их место запишется наш образ.

Win32 Disk Imager
Win32 Disk Imager

После окончания установки НЕОБХОДИМО в корневую папку карты памяти добавить пустой созданный файл ssh.txt, чтобы активировать протокол SSH удалённой командной строки.

ВАЖНО! Добавить файл ssh.txt в корневую папку необходимо до первого запуска RPi.

Затем вставить карту памяти в устройство Rapberry Pi, подать питание через разъём MicroUSB устройства.

ВАЖНО! Соблюдайте последовательность: не вставляйте карту памяти после подачи питания!

После всех подготовительных манипуляций приступим к первому запуску :)

Соедините устройство Raspberry Pi, компьютер и маршрутизатор в единую LAN-сеть. В маршрутизаторе должен быть активирован DHCP-сервер(по умолчанию в домашнем роутере он включен автоматически, можете за это не беспокоится)))

Примечание! В случае отсутствия маршрутизатора можно подключить устройство Raspberry Pi и компьютер напрямую друг к другу, на компьютере установить и запустить любой программный DHCP-сервер, например,

С помощью Advanced Port Scanner определим IP-адрес устройства raspberrypi, который нам выделил наш роутер.

Advanced Port Scanner
Advanced Port Scanner

Запускаем программу Putty, и настраиваем её для подключения к RPi следующим образом:

  • Host Name (or IP address): ранее определённый IP-адрес устройства
  • Port: 22 (всегда)
  • Connection type: SSH (всегда)

Нажимаем кнопку Open.

Putty
Putty

На экране компьютера появится командная строка ОС Linux Debian, установленной RPI. Требуется ввести логин (pi) и пароль (raspberry). Дефолтный пароль после подключения желательно сменить, но об этом поговорим в следующей статье.

Консоль Putty
Консоль Putty

При вводе пароля, пароль не отображается в консоли - это нормально. Нажмите Enter, когда закончите ввод.

Вот мы и подключились к нашему микрокомпьютеру по SSh порту. На cегодня всё :-D

Подписывайтесь, комментируйте, помогите развить этот интересный проект.